It's interesting...I don't remember Dutchvalue giving off douchy vibes like Joc pre-Cubs, but I don't think Joc had any hits in the 2 Dodgers playoff series that hurt even close to as much as Todd's 3 run double in Game 6 of the 2003 NLCS. In fact looking at the numbers he helped the Cubs, going a combined 5-26 (.491 OPS) with 2 extra base hits (both doubles), 1 RBI and a 39% K rate in the 2 series. Todd was actually pretty awesome for the Cubs in 2004 and was starting to play every day until he got hurt for the season in like June. In 2005 he came back and was terrible before being traded in August to the braves. To me the worst thing about Todd was that he was so bad with the Marlins in 03, they had to bring up a 20-year-old Miggy early and he helped them get them the WC and the rest is history. My memory is pretty fuzzy, but it seems like he was blocking some prospect from getting regular playing time while he was with the Cubs.
